    It's only been exciting when we had O'Sullivan, genuine direct play with width. All we have now is an overloaded midfield with very little flair out wide! Watkins is trying, but is very up and down during a game, he's looked shattered for me. Hopefully now with no Tuesday games him and one or two others will benefit from the weeks rest. I'm not a fan of Harris, although he played well at Scunny....but Scunny really are awful. He like others has no end product, this is one issue with Crowley at the moment, he's playing really well, beating player 2 or 3 times but trying to beat them again instead of playing the killer ball!! I really hope Bree can get fit as I rate him a million times more than Wabarra who just seems to go through the motions at times for me! Scowen had the worst game I'd seen him play yesterday, and when he plays bad we struggle.

    Winnall is totally wasted up front on his own, he's a goal scorer, and a good one at that at this level, he needs to be in and around the box, not with his back to goal 40 yards from goal and out wide. Need him up top with Smith or someone. I really don't know why we didn't go back in for Cole, he has genuine pace which we are crying out for up top, we don't stretch defenders enough to create space up front. I want to see exciting football, balls out wide, wingers running at people, full bacs doing the same and over lapping and getting crosses in. Smith played well at Scunny at left back, he likes to cross and come forward, whilst playing Lewin at LB it is just far too negative at home, he's a good center back and needs to play alongside one of Roberts or Mawson, the 2 together are conceding too many goals together!

    Off the pitch, everything is so flat...understandable at times like this. Who on earth is going to pay £17 on the gate as a kid, and £25-27 as an adult to come and watch this. Half a row in front of us was empty, we have prime seats, 6 rows from the top almost central at the ponty end! We MUST do an offer for at least 2 or 3 games a season, every other club does now and again. Kid for a quid, friend for a fiver, even go for a big gate and make it ten and five pound for everyone & anyone and you can pay in advance & on the gate, open up the north for home fans when we do this, some teams only bring 200!! Get some life into the stadium. Do these offers a couple of times, and on a Saturday game, not a Tuesday game where you have to buy in advance!! Season ticket holders are still saving £100s and I'd rather see people in for cheap than not at all!

    Also, which other team has there main entrance music barley played at all, we fire up timerider as the teams are already walking out, then turn it off after about 10 seconds, some may not care about this and find it petty, but go to most other grounds and they have there main music cranked up leading up to the team entering and leave it on a minute or two. My mam keeps saying why are we walking out to no music, whoever runs the match-day build up needs to sort this out as it's just so flat. I was drawn into Oakwell when younger loving the atmosphere, Toby running about getting up to all sorts, Ponty end penalty's with Toby, I remembered timerider cranking up in advance and the fans clapping before the teams came out, now we just walk out to nothing, it's as if here we go again and whatever!! The whole place needs some energy for the fans to get excited, and we need to get people down now and again before people fall away for good!!
